CHATTANOOGA, TN -- Chattanooga State Community College plans to host its alumni on Nov. 29, 2023, welcoming them back to campus with a reception and presentation honoring graduates throughout the college's nearly 60-year history.

Alumni will gather to enjoy light refreshments from 5 to 6:30 p.m. in the Faculty Staff Dining Room on ChattState’s campus (OMNI Building, Room 124). Attendees must RSVP online by Nov. 22.

Following the Alumni Reception, the festivities will shift to the gymnasium, where, between the women's and men's basketball games, the college will recognize its ChattState Royal Homecoming Court. Alumni Association Board president Dennis Tumlin will then take to the floor to announce plans to establish an alumni awards program and recognize members of the Half Century Alumni Club. 

"I'm thrilled to announce our plans for an alumni awards program and to recognize the outstanding members of our Half Century Alumni Club," Tumlin said. "It's a testament to the enduring spirit of the ChattState community, and we look forward to celebrating this milestone with our alumni at the upcoming homecoming event." 

ChattState’s Student Experience Office organized three days of homecoming festivities leading up to the Tigers taking on the Motlow Bucks on the evening of Wednesday, Nov. 29.

On Monday, Nov. 27, the Homecoming Court will be announced in the Main Café at 11:30 a.m. Students can start voting for the Royals immediately after the presentation.

On Tuesday, students are encouraged to wear blue and orange throughout the day to show off their ChattState school spirit. Participants will Paint the Rock at 10 a.m., and a pep rally introducing the men’s and women’s basketball teams will take place at 11:30 a.m. in the amphitheater.

On Wednesday, homecoming revelers will kick off game day at 10:30 a.m. with a parade. After the parade ends, Tigers fans will gather in the McCormick Center parking lot for a homecoming tailgate.

The Women’s Basketball Team will take on the Bucks starting at 5:30 p.m., and the men’s team will take to the court at 7:30 p.m. A homecoming ceremony, including recognition of the ChattState Royals and an Alumni Board presentation, will be held between games.
